Chrysler Recall F45: Hood Latch Striker
2007 Chrysler Sebring
If the hood opens while driving, a crash could occur without prior warning.
Structure — Body — Hood
- Summary
- On certain passenger vehicles, the hood latch striker may break and allow the hood to open while driving.
- Actions
- Dealers will replace the hood latch strikers free of charge. The recall began on November 27, 2006. Owners may contact DaimlerChrysler at 1-800-853-1403.
